Output 577f28fc1b82f6bfd93bfb0163a3fc4e9f08d8f5ef39fcca95305bd686ff02c3:3

value
41443132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9589ba27e26f161ea7908d6f9bcfbc81023f1e9 OP_EQUAL
address
3NxqWq13DzCdMQyBg4UWetRCYykmbsYVWy
transaction
577f28fc1b82f6bfd93bfb0163a3fc4e9f08d8f5ef39fcca95305bd686ff02c3
spent
true